This study tested the comparison of user experience (user Experience) on the mobile apps Ho-Jak, Go-Jek and Grab by doing surveys for mecari difference experience felt by a third user group application. User Experience is measured through Variable Sub Happiness, Task Success, Earning and Uptime. This research uses descriptive comparative analysis method with the quantitative approach. The research examined objects i.e. the user Experience. The analysis of the data used are the paired t-test. Based on the results of the study, a descriptive analysis of the Results showed that of the four sub variable user Experience that is Happiness, Task Success, Earning, and the average Uptime of the positive assessment given to applications Go-Jek as a platform that can be deliver a good experience to its users. This is one of them because of the emergence of Ho-Jak comes first in Banda Aceh if compared with the Grab and Go-Jek, thus allowing the Ho-Jak and similar business can better understand the desires of users based on doing the research activities , planning, development and testing that has been done in the neighborhood of Banda Aceh. Keywords: User Experience, mobile services, Ho-Jak, Go-Jek, Grab.

This study aims to analyze the implementation of e-government policies in SKPD within the Aceh Government and their impact on employee performance. Considering that work morale can also be an important determinant of performance formation, in this study employee morale is used as an intermediary variable between employee performance and the implementation of e-government policies. The research uses a quantitative approach with a causal design that examines the functional relationship between employee performance and the implementation of e-government and work morale. The unit of analysis is 47 SKPD in the ranks of the Aceh Government. Research respondents in each SKPD as many as 5 people so that the total respondents are 235 employees. Collecting data using a questionnaire distributed to employees in each SKPD. The questionnaire contains questions related to employee performance, e-government policies, and works morale. Each statement provided alternative answer choices in the form of a level of agreement ranging from strongly disagree, disagree, disagree, agree, and strongly agree. Each answer choice is given a score based on a Likert scale with a weight of 1 to 5. In order to test the functional relationship between variables, the AMOS 21 statistical inference model structural equation model (SEM) is used. This is done through efforts to improve the quality of e-government implementation and strengthen employee morale. Each SKPD head should pay attention to the importance of improving the quality of e-government which has been implemented so far in improving the quality of public services. Along with the development of information and communication technology, the implementation of e-government needs to be balanced with innovation in the field of public services. Besides being able to have an impact on improving the work of carrying out tasks by employees, service innovations supported by e-government will have a good impact on the quality of services for the community

Automated Trading Systems & Autopilot Manual Trading training for 6 days on 10-15 January 2023 provides an understanding of the concepts and workings of ATS and AMT as well as risk management in trading. This training is expected to make participants more independent in trading and able to maximize the use of ATS and AMT to gain profits in their investments. In addition, this training is expected to make a positive contribution in increasing financial literacy and investment in society. However, this needs to be done in a structured and comprehensive manner so that capital market participants understand the potential risks that may arise when using Automated Trading Systems and Autopilot Manual Trading in their investment activities. The recommendation that can be made is to hold regular training and outreach, both by regulators, securities companies, and capital market associations. With effective training and outreach as well as strict supervision, it is hoped that capital market players will be able to optimize their investment potential by avoiding unwanted risks. This training can also help increase awareness and understanding of sharia compliance in investing in the Indonesian sharia capital market.
